About Msci Inc

MSCI describes its mission as enabling investors to build better portfolios for a better world. MSCI's largest and most profitable segment is its index segment, where it provides benchmarking to asset managers and asset owners. In addition, it boasts over $1 trillion in ETF assets linked to MSCI indexes. The MSCI analytics segment provides portfolio management and risk management analytics software to asset managers and asset owners. MSCI's all other segment was broken out into ESG and climate and private assets segments in 2021. In ESG and climate, MSCI provides ESG data to the investment industry. In the private assets side, MSCI provides real restate reporting, market data, benchmarking, and analytics to investors and real estate managers.

About D Wave Quantum Inc

D-Wave Quantum Inc. is a global leader in the development and delivery of quantum computing systems, software, and services. The company specializes in annealing quantum computers designed to solve complex optimization problems across industries such as logistics, materials science, and financial modeling. D-Wave offers its technology through the cloud, allowing customers to build and run real-world quantum applications today, making it a key player in the commercialization of quantum computing.
